Final Answer:
1. a pause — “I was going to say… but then I changed my mind.”
2. hesitation — “Um… I think the answer is… maybe 7?”
3. an incomplete thought — “She started to run, but then…”
4. the passage of time — “We played all day… and by nightfall, we were exhausted.”
